Lost driving licence in Morocco: request a duplicate

In case of loss, theft or damage to a driving licence, NARSA provides a duplicate procedure distinct from a first application or an exchange.

Quick answer

The Khadamat NARSA page on duplicates indicates filing through authorized Al Barid Bank / Barid Cash networks for the service concerned and a list of documents including notably the loss or theft declaration, identity, proof of payment, a recent medical certificate and compliant photos.

What to check before you begin

The 400 DH tariff is the amount displayed on the NARSA duplicate page consulted on 23 August 2026. As a public tariff may be revised, check it before payment. An expired licence or a foreign licence to be exchanged follows a different process from a duplicate.

Requirements and preliminary checks

  • Have lost, had stolen or no longer be able to use the original title under the applicable reason.
  • Be able to prove your identity and situation.
  • Provide the declaration or document corresponding to the reason.

Documents and information to prepare

The list below is intended to help you prepare. If the official portal displays a different or more precise list for your situation, the official list takes precedence.

  • Loss or theft declaration depending on the situation.
  • Identity document.
  • Receipt or proof of the applicable payment.
  • Medical certificate less than three months old when requested.
  • Two 35 × 45 mm photos with a blue background according to the NARSA sheet.

How to complete the procedure: the steps

  1. Consult the NARSA duplicate page and check the corresponding reason.
  2. Have a loss or theft declaration drawn up if necessary.
  3. Prepare the medical certificate, photos and other documents indicated.
  4. Submit the file and make payment through the authorized channel indicated by NARSA.
  5. Keep the receipt and follow the instructions until the duplicate is issued.

Fees, deadlines and information that may change

At the time of verification, the NARSA page indicates 400 DH for a duplicate. Check the amount before payment on the official portal, as well as the authorized filing channel.

Common mistakes to avoid

  • Use the duplicate process for a driving licence that has simply expired or needs exchanging.
  • Forgetting the loss/theft declaration.
  • Submitting a medical certificate older than the stated period.
  • Paying on a site that imitates NARSA’s visual identity.

How much does a duplicate driving licence cost in Morocco?

The NARSA page consulted shows 400 DH. Check the current fee before payment.

What is needed if a driving licence is lost?

NARSA requires, among other things, a loss or theft declaration, identity documentation and the other documents listed in the duplicate pathway.

Is a medical certificate required?

The NARSA page consulted mentions a medical certificate less than three months old.

Where should the application be submitted?

Follow the channel indicated on Khadamat NARSA; the service page mentions authorized Al Barid Bank / Barid Cash networks for the filing concerned.
